Definition

To happen or exist in a particular situation or place. It can also mean to come into someone's mind as a thought or idea.

Usage & Nuances

"Occur" is more formal than "happen" and is common in writing, news, and academic contexts: "The problem occurred at night." It is also used in patterns like "occur in nature" and "It occurred to me that..." Learners often say "what was occurred"; use "what occurred" or more naturally "what happened."

Example Sentences

The accident occurred near the school.

These birds only occur in this part of the country.

It suddenly occurred to me that I forgot my keys.

Most of the damage occurred during the storm last night.

If any problems occur, call me right away.

It never occurred to us that she might say no.
